OCS Group are recruiting for a Digital Helpdesk Apprentice to support their contract delivery team working with the Scottish Police Authority (SPA). The role is an exciting new position to support the project management team in delivering maintenance project works throughout the estate.

Responsibilities:

  • Acting as a first point of contact and providing digital support to the helpdesk team
  • Raising and closing jobs and system work orders on our inhouse reactive system
  • Raising quotes and purchase orders?on our Computer Aided Facility Management (CAFM) System Concept
  • Working with helpdesk team to ensure seamless management of contracts
  • Managing a centralised email inbox on MS Outlook and diary management
  • Booking in reactive and PPM (pre planned maintenance) tasks
  • Dealing with subcontractors and using Excel for data entry
